My Question or Issue

 I've been having an issue which when I searched seems to be pretty common: Several times I've gotten a notification that my music is playing on another, unpaired, device. This has happened even when I'm not connected on wifi... Then yesterday when I was playing music offline I noticed there were songs and albums saved to my library that I have never picked. This made me think my ID/password had been compromised so I went through the process of resetting it. I got the notification email to reset, changed it and then selected "sign off from all my devices" in my profile... Well, after doing that and logging back in to my account on my phone, now my library is completely empty. It looks like I've lost all my songs, plus my premium membership is not being recognized. Please give me some guidance.

Hey @user-removed,

 

In this case, I'd recommend getting in touch with the Spotify support team by following these steps:

 

  1. Go to the contact form.
  2. Select Logging in.
  3. Choose I can't log in to Spotify
  4. Click I STILL NEED HELP.

They'll be able to take a look at your issue, and you'll hear from them shortly.

It sounds like you might be logged into the wrong account. It's possible to create multiple Spotify accounts, each with their own login details, saved music, and subscription. Please check to see if you have any other accounts.
